什么是'哈希'用于App_Code.compiled文件的值?

时间:2015-04-16 15:27:15

标签: asp.net .net

我正在浏览我发布网站时生成的App_Code.compiled文件。它看起来像:

<?xml version="1.0" encoding="utf-8"?>
<preserve resultType="6" virtualPath="/ProjectFolderName/App_Code/" hash="5b4133b" filehash="" flags="140000" assembly="App_Code" />

我想知道hash的价值用于什么?

1 个答案:

答案 0 :(得分:0)

哈希值用于消除文件名的歧义,因此可以将页面与过去的编辑进行比较并检查更改。

&#39;散列&#39;用于检查当前页面的更改,而&#39; filehash&#39;用于检查页面所依赖的任何源文件。